And most surely this is a revelation from the Lord of the worlds. 192 which the truthful spirit has carried down 193 To thy heart and mind, that thou mayest admonish. 194 in a clear, Arabic tongue. 195 And verily, it (the Quran, and its revelation to Prophet Muhammad SAW) is (announced) in the Scriptures [i.e. the Taurat (Torah) and the Injeel (Gospel)] of former people. 196 Is it not a sign to them that the learned men of the Israelites know it? 197 Had We revealed it to any of the non-Arabs, 198 and he had recited it to them, they would not have believed in it. 199 Even so We have caused it to enter into the hearts of the sinners, 200 They will not believe in it until they see the painful punishment. 201 It shall come unto them on a sudden, and they shall not perceive. 202 and they will say, 'Shall we be respited?' 203 Do they, then, [really] wish that Our chastisement be hastened on? 204 But hast thou ever considered [this]: If We do allow them to enjoy [this life] for some years, 205 And then cometh that which they were promised, 206 (How) that wherewith they were contented naught availeth them? 207 And We did not destroy any city except that it had warners 208 As a reminder; and never have We been unjust. 209 And it is not the Shayatin (devils) who have brought it (this Quran) down, 210 It is not meet for them, nor is it in their power, 211 Indeed they are debarred from even hearing it. 212 So invoke not with Allah another ilah (god) lest you be among those who receive punishment. 213 And warn, [O Muhammad], your closest kindred. 214 Lower thy wing to those who follow thee, being believers; 215 If they disobey you, say, "I bear no responsibility for what you do." 216 Put your trust in the Almighty, the Most Merciful, 217 Who observes you when you rise (to pray) 218 and when thou turnest about among those who bow. 219 Verily He! He is the Hearer, the Knower. 220 Shall I tell you on whom the satans descend? 221 They come down on every guilty impostor. 222 The devils convey upon them what they heard, but most of them are liars. 223 And as for the poets -- it is the misled who follow them. 224 Hast thou not seen how they stray in every valley, 225 And that they say that which they do not? 226 Except those who believe (in the Oneness of Allah Islamic Monotheism), and do righteous deeds, and remember Allah much, and reply back (in poetry) to the unjust poetry (which the pagan poets utter against the Muslims). And those who do wrong will come to know by what overturning they will be overturned. 227
Allah Almighty has spoken the truth.
End of Surah: The Poets (Alshu'araa'). Sent down in Mecca after The Inevitable (Al-Waaqe'ah) before The Ant (Al-Naml)
